Synthesis of 2,3-Dihydroisoxazoles from Propargylic N-Hydroxylamines via Zn(II)-Catalyzed Ring-Closure Reaction

Patrick Aschwanden, Doug E. Frantz and Erick M. Carreira

*Laboratorium für Organische Chemie, ETH Zürich, HCI H335, Vladimir-Prelog-Weg 3, 8093 Zürich, Switzerland, Email: carreiraorg.chem.ethz.ch

P. Aschwanden, D. E. Frantz, E. M. Carreira, Org. Lett., 2000, 2, 2331-2333.

DOI: 10.1021/ol006095r


Abstract

The combination of ZnI2 and DMAP catalyzes a mild cyclization reaction of propargylic N-hydroxylamines to 2,3,5-trisubstituted 2,3-dihydroisoxazoles.
